Sensor multi-application sensors are not intended for high pressure truck applications and have a

maximum potential pressure reading of approximately 50 psi to 65 psi, but can vary by application

with some TPMS scan tools.

REDI-Sensor multi-application sensors may be used exclusively on a vehicle, or in combination with

other OE or aftermarket sensors on a vehicle, including clamp-in, snap-in, and valveless (banded)

styles.

Excluding part number SE10001HP / SE10001HPR (HP = High Pressure / R = Rubber Stem),

REDI-REDI-Sensor multi-application sensors do not respond to magnet triggering, however REDI-REDI-Sensor

multi-application sensors can be used in combination with OE magnet trigger sensors or as

replacement for all the OE magnet trigger sensors on a vehicle. For vehicles using OE magnet

trigger sensors, continue to use a magnet for the OE sensors and use a TPMS scan tool for

REDI-Sensor multi-application sensors. Note that limited OE magnet trigger sensors will also dual trigger

combinations, OE auto-learn by driving or delta pressure (temporarily adjusting tire air pressure +/- 2

psi, be sure to never exceed maximum inflation pressure on tire sidewall) methods may be used

instead.

Direct TPMS sensors only need replacement if the battery fails or if the sensor is damaged.

Replace the sensor seal, attachment nut, valve core, cap, and washer (service kit) during tire service.

Depending on the application, these serviceable parts can vary. However, the idea remains the same – replacing

these parts is preventive maintenance for the TPMS sensors, and the profits help recoup those lost from

standard tire valve/stem sales that typically no longer come on direct TPMS-equipped vehicles.

Most TPMS sensors have lithium perchlorate or lithium manganese-based batteries and should be properly

disposed of when the usable life has expired.

Never offer to deactivate the TPM System for a customer. Instead, help reinforce the safety, convenience, and

economic value of the system to the customer.

Nitrogen is not required, however it is perfectly acceptable for use with VDO TPMS sensors. A filtered air

inflation system that removes moisture and dirt can help reduce potential corrosion to the inner wheel.

TPMS is a supplemental tire safety system, and is not a replacement for regularly-scheduled tire pressure

checks and maintenance.

Do not use plain brass valve cores with TPMS sensor valves, as the valve core can easily corrode inside the

valve stem leading to frozen/seized parts.

Some types of metallic window film (tinting) and accessory vehicle electronics or phones can cause interference

with the TPMS.

Tires are the only connection a car has to the road. Their proper maintenance, including proper tire inflation

pressure and regular tire rotation, therefore directly impacts all aspects of driving including handling, braking,

hydroplaning avoidance, ride comfort, MPG/emissions, tire life, and overall vehicle safety. Explaining these tire

facts to your customer will help build perceived value and understanding when there are necessary tire or TPMS

service costs.

Aside from valveless tire inner liner sensors, never use glue with TPMS sensors. Glue is not intended for

installing or repairing snap-in, clamp-in, or banded sensors, and may fail in the harshness of the tire

environment. For valveless tire inner liner sensors, only use the specified glue.

Never use plastic zip ties with TPMS sensors. Plastic zip ties are not intended for installing or repairing sensors,

and may fail in the harshness of the tire environment.

Do not attempt to solder or fuse together any broken components on a TPMS sensor. When a component on a

TPMS sensor is broken, there oftentimes is more damage than immediately meets the eye. Additionally, such

a repair may jeopardize the proper functionality (measurement accuracy, tire air sealing, etc.) of the sensor.

Do not attempt TPMS sensor battery replacement. Once you open up a TPMS sensor, the protective

waterproofing, anti-static, etc. barrier is destroyed and will result in a non-functioning or highly jeopardized

limited life sensor.
